Buying Guide: Key Considerations For Co-Sleeper Cribs

  • Growth trajectory: Consider whether you need a unit that converts from bassinet to crib and beyond, or a standalone bedside sleeper that stays compact.
  • Bed compatibility: Check how the product attaches to your bed. Look for secure straps, gaps avoided, and appropriate height adjustments to reduce baby entrapment risk.
  • Portability and space: If space is tight, prioritize foldable designs or lighter frames. For frequent room changes, wheels with locks are essential.
  • Safety standards: Look for certifications (e.g., SGS, CPSIA/CPSC compliance) and robust frame construction, especially for metal alloys and joint connections.
  • Viewability and accessibility: Mesh walls and clear visibility help you monitor baby quickly. Consider models with adjustable side panels or breathable fabrics.
  • Maintenance: Removable fabrics and machine-washable liners reduce cleaning effort. Consider how easy it is to disassemble for travel or storage.
  • Longevity: If you want to use the product through multiple growth stages, ensure the included conversion parts or optional kits are available and clearly documented.

FAQ: Quick Answers For Buyers

  1. What is a co-sleeper crib best for?
  2. It provides close proximity for nighttime feeding and soothing while maintaining a separate, safe sleeping space for the baby.

  3. Do these products require assembly?
  4. Most require some assembly. Check the product manual for tools needed and assembly time estimates before purchase.

  5. Are these safe with tall beds?
  6. Yes, many models offer adjustable height and secure straps. Always follow manufacturer guidelines to prevent gaps or instability at the bed edge.

  7. Can I use these with a year-old who leaves the bed often?
  8. Some units offer higher weight limits or convertible configurations ideal for toddlers. Review weight and height specifications to ensure continued safety.

  9. What maintenance steps are recommended?
  10. Regularly inspect joints and straps, clean fabric surfaces per care instructions, and ensure wheels lock securely before use.

  11. Are there differences between 3-in-1 and 5- or 9-in-1 models?
  12. 3-in-1 models focus on core uses (bassinet, bedside sleeper, cradle). 5- and 9-in-1 units expand to more conversions, offering longer usage but potentially higher weight and setup complexity.
